Album Info

Artist: This Mortal Coil
Album: It'll End In Tears
Released: UK, 1 Oct 1984

Tracklist:

A1Kangaroo3:31
Bass, Acoustic Guitar, Synthesizer [DX7] - Simon Raymonde
Cello - Martin McGarrick
Vocals - Gordon Sharp
Written-By - Alex Chilton
A2Song To The Siren3:30
Guitar - Robin Guthrie
Vocals - Elizabeth Fraser
Written-By - Tim Buckley
A3Holocaust3:38
Cello - Martin McGarrick
Piano - Steven Young
Violin, Viola - Gini Ball
Vocals - Howard Devoto
Written-By - Alex Chilton
A4Fyt4:24
Organ - Mark Cox
Synthesizer - Martyn Young
Written-By - T.M.C.
A5Fond Affections3:51
Guitar, Bass, Synthesizer - Martyn Young
Synthesizer [DX7] - Mark Cox
Vocals - Gordon Sharp
Written-By - Rema-Rema
A6The Last Ray4:08
Bass - Simon Raymonde
Electric Guitar [6 And 12-string Electric Guitars], E-Bow, Acoustic Guitar - Robin Guthrie
Written By - Ivo, S. Raymonde, R. Guthrie
Written-By - Ivo, R. Guthrie, S. Raymonde
B1Another Day2:54
Cello, Arranged By [String Arrangement] - Martin McGarrick
Violin, Viola - Gini Ball
Vocals - Elizabeth Fraser
Written-By - Roy Harper
B2Waves Become Wings4:26
Accordion, Vocals - Lisa Gerrard
Written-By - Lisa Gerrard
B3Barramundi3:56
Accordion [Looped Accordion] - Lisa Gerrard
Guitar [Guitars], Synthesizer [DX7] - Simon Raymonde
Written-By - S. Raymonde
B4Dreams Made Flesh3:48
Drone [Bass Drone], Drum - Brendan Perry
Written-By - Lisa Gerrard
Yang T'Chin, Vocals - Lisa Gerrard
B5Not Me3:44
Bass - Simon Raymonde
Guitar - Manuela Rickers, Robin Guthrie
Vocals - Robbie Grey
Written-By - Colin Newman
B6A Single Wish2:27
Piano - Steven Young
Synthesizer [DX7], Effects [Gizmo] - Simon Raymonde
Vocals - Gordon Sharp
Written By - S. Raymonde, S. Young, G. Sharp
Written-By - G. Sharp, S. Raymonde, S. Young

Description

Released on May 1, 1984, "It'll End in Tears" is the debut album by the British musical project This Mortal Coil, which was conceived by 4AD label founder Ivo Watts-Russell. This album is often hailed as a landmark in the post-punk and dream pop genres, and it has left an indelible mark on the music landscape, influencing countless artists and bands that followed.

The album is a collection of covers and original compositions, featuring a hauntingly beautiful sound that blends ethereal vocals, lush instrumentation, and a melancholic atmosphere.
